Why is SOPH’s price down today? (05/06/2026)

TLDR

Sophon is down 8.05% to $0.00563 in 24h, underperforming a broadly weaker crypto market primarily driven by a risk-off sell-off that is hitting low-liquidity altcoins hardest.

  1. Primary reason: Broad market deleveraging and extreme fear sentiment, with Bitcoin dropping 3.59% and over $1.6B in liquidations pressuring all risk assets.

  2. Secondary reasons: Sophon's thin liquidity and high-beta profile amplified the downturn, with its 24h trading volume down 31% to just $5.6M.

  3. Near-term market outlook: If Bitcoin stabilizes above $60,000, SOPH could consolidate near $0.0056; a break below risks a retest of its yearly low near $0.005.

Deep Dive

1. Market-Wide Risk-Off Move

The drop occurred within a broader crypto market decline, where the total market cap fell 3.03% to $2.14T. Bitcoin fell 3.59% to $61,719, triggering over $1.6 billion in leveraged liquidations and pushing the Fear & Greed Index to "Extreme Fear" at 17. In such environments, capital flees higher-risk assets like smaller altcoins first.

What it means: Sophon’s move was not driven by a coin-specific catalyst but by a macro sell-off where altcoins underperform.

Watch for: Bitcoin's ability to hold the $60,000–$61,000 support zone, which would be a key signal for broader market stabilization.

2. Low Liquidity Amplifying Losses

Sophon's 24h trading volume is relatively low at $5.6 million, which is down 31% from the previous day. This thin market depth makes the token more susceptible to large sell orders, allowing price to move more sharply on modest flows.

What it means: The token's high beta nature means it falls faster than Bitcoin during market downturns, as seen with its 8.05% drop versus BTC's 3.59% decline.

3. Near-term Market Outlook

The immediate path hinges on Bitcoin's stability. If BTC holds above $60,000, SOPH may find support and range between $0.0055 and $0.0060. However, if market fear persists and BTC breaks lower, SOPH could quickly test its yearly low near $0.005.

What it means: The trend remains bearish but oversold, setting up for a potential relief bounce if broader sentiment improves.

Watch for: A sustained recovery in global crypto market cap above $2.2T, which would signal renewed risk appetite.

Conclusion

Market Outlook: Bearish Pressure Sophon’s decline is a symptom of a fearful market punishing illiquid altcoins. A durable rebound requires both a stabilization in Bitcoin and an increase in SOPH-specific demand or volume. Key watch: Monitor whether Sophon's daily volume recovers above $8M, which would indicate renewed trader interest and could help the price stabilize.
